Do You Need To Dye Your Hair To Make Colorful Braided Hairstyles?

No, you do not need to dye your natural hair to make any coloured braid style. When making these styles, you’ll typically use coloured braiding hair extensions, which cover most of the hair underneath, so there’s no need to dye your hair. However, you can do so if you want a seamless blend of colour between the braiding hair and your natural hair.

Can I Mix Different Colors Of Braiding Hair To Make My Braids?

You can absolutely combine different colours of braiding hair if you want a blend of multiple colours. The blending method would vary depending on how you want the style to look. You can combine both shades of braiding hair right before braiding or use a feed-in method to incorporate the different colours at the ends of the braids.

How Long Do Coloured Braids Last?

Just like most protective styles with hair extensions, coloured braids will typically last anywhere between 4-8 weeks.

What Colors Look Best on Dark and Light Skin Tones?

Black is a classic colour that looks incredible on both light and dark skin tones. However, if you’re opting for coloured hair, some of the best colours for dark skin tones include copper red, silver, wine, honey, and caramel brown. If your skin is on the lighter side, some great colours to try include ash blonde, light brown, red, and grey.

Can I Wear Lighter Colours If I have a Darker Skin Tone?

Yes! You can absolutely wear lighter-coloured braids if you have a darker skin tone. Coloured braiding hair often comes in many different shades, so there is always a tone to fit dark skin tones no matter what colour you’d like to try.

Will I look professional with a colourful hairstyle?

You can wear colourful hairstyles in a professional setting. However, it might be best to go for neutral and earthy colours like brown or dark red. Unconventional bright colours are best suited to people who don’t work in a formal office setting.
